The city of Boras is a major train junction. The Coast-to-Coast line from Gothenburg to Kalmar goes through the center of the city, meeting with the Alvsborg Line (heading north to Herrljunga and Uddevalla) and the Viskadal Line (heading south to Varberg). All trains on these lines stop at Boras train station. It is likewise a central train terminal for the regional traffic agency Vasttrafik, which runs continuous passenger trains in both directions between Boras and Gothenburg. The Barbados Transport Board was developed in June of 1955 by draft legislation approved by the Governor of Barbados. 3 months later on, an act of Parliament was handed down August 24, 1955, developing the company as a legal entity. It was established to supply vital public transport services and is an essential constituent of the country's economic development.
The transportation board's objective is to make sure that employees can get to and from work securely. It likewise aims to assist the tourism sector, which is an important component of the country's economy. The organization aims to offer a variety of different bus routes in order to accommodate as many commuters as possible. Currently, it operates 98 routes throughout the island. Its head office is located at Roebuck Street in Bridgetown. In addition, the organisation has 3 terminals: Fairchild Street, Bridgetown; Princess Alice Highway, St. Michael; and Speightstown, St. Peter.
